The Political and Economic Power of Immigrants, Latinos, and Asians in Vermont.
Immigrants and their children are growing shares of Vermont’s population and electorate.
Roughly 2.5% of Vermonters are Latino or Asian.
Latino and Asian entrepreneurs and consumers add millions of dollars and hundreds of jobs to Vermont’s economy.
Immigrants are important to Vermont’s economy as workers and taxpayers.
Immigrants are important to Vermont’s economy as students.
Immigrants excel educationally.
